Svyhledat odkaz pomocí proměnné

Programy pro práci v kanceláři (Word, Excel, Access…=>Office)

Moderátor: Mods_senior

Odpovědět
Veverka77
nováček
Příspěvky: 3
Registrován: 10 led 2017 15:57

Svyhledat odkaz pomocí proměnné

Příspěvek od Veverka77 »

Ahoj,
potřebuji poradit, jak upravit tento kód v makru excelu:

Kód: Vybrat vše

ActiveCell.FormulaR1C1 = "=IFERROR(VLOOKUP(RC[-5],[sešit_k_úpravě.xlsx]Výkony!R2C4:R64000C5,2,FALSE),0)"
tak, aby místo názvu sešitu (sešit_k_úpravě.xlsx) byla použita proměnná (otevrenysesit1)

Děkuji za nasměrování
guest

Re: Svyhledat odkaz pomocí proměnné

Příspěvek od guest »

Kód: Vybrat vše

Dim strSesit As String

strSesit = "muj_sesit"

ActiveCell.FormulaR1C1 = "=IFERROR(VLOOKUP(RC[-5],[" & strSesit & "]Výkony!R2C4:R64000C5,2,FALSE),0)"
Tuším ale, že s prominutím vymýšlíte zbytečné, až nebezpečné bejkárny (odkazovat se do zavřeného sešitu není dobrý nápad, do jiného otevřeného vzorcem v makru je taky divný nápad a pokud sešit neexistuje, šups a máte tam dialog...), čili proč uvádíte název sešitu...
Odpovědět
  • Podobná témata
    Odpovědi
    Zobrazení
    Poslední příspěvek
  • Nic se nenačítá ani po resetu biosu pomocí cmos baterie
    od Bliske » » v Problémy s hardwarem
    4 Odpovědi
    6673 Zobrazení
    Poslední příspěvek od pcmaker

Zpět na „Kancelářské balíky“